Transaction aabb6ba95de3282f2ac76ffcc0372b0b8e2fc5b084992082d30f0b834c6d8a70
1 Input
1 Outputs
- aabb6ba95de3282f2ac76ffcc0372b0b8e2fc5b084992082d30f0b834c6d8a70:0
value 910882
address 18cbZqwRFZriHkVmZwoTT8D4jm4AKSwr8G